Ofcourse RCC columns have to be designed in accordance to the total load on the columns but apart from that it is essential for every Civil engineer and Architect to remember a few thumb rules so that they are prevented from making mistakes.
!lignment of Columns
" rectangular grid is to be made for placing the columns. This helps in avoiding mistakes and placing in columns can be done in the right way.
6ig,ag arrangement of columns is an absolutely wrong way of working out &tructural design. It should be remembered that when columns are erected, beams are laid connecting the columns.
